Sore
The Middle English Dictionary · 1922 · p. 5
, Sare , adj. sore; in pain, XVI 204, 205; grievous, V 48, X 51; n. wound, V 278 ( see Rof, and note); pain, grief, II 263, 560, XV c 33; adv. sore(ly), bitterly, exceedingly, I 88, IV a 59, VI 190, X 141, XIV b 60, . [OE. sār , n. and adj.; sāre , adv.]
